- Geological map of the area surrounding McMurdo Sound, Antarctica showing the location of the ship's winter quarters and camps. Relief shown by contours and spot heights.
- Oriented with north to the bottom.
- Library copy annotated in black ink and pencil.
- Handwritten in lower left corner: Used on western sledge-journey Antarctica 1911, G. Taylor.
- "14. 1902 map used as base for 1911-12 surveys in the hut -- C. Evans, Griffith Taylor"--On verso.
